The means an individual stands or beings in front of the camera is extremely important in a portrait. The body has its very own language; the present itself, the lines of the body, and the position of the limbs share the state of mind and personality of the person (Chino Hills Graduation Pictures Photographers Near Me). The shape and setting of the body additionally add to the composition, bringing dynamic forms and lines right into the frame
Any position, whether it is an unabridged photo or a bust picture, begins with the placement of the feet, as it determines the total placement of the person and their comfort or discomfort. Generally, the much foot is at a 90 angle to the video camera and the front foot is looking directly at the cam, with the body naturally transforming at a slight angle.
If one leg is unwinded, the knee and ankle bend, and the position becomes looser. It is best to move the body weight to the leg farthest from the camera so that the thigh does not show up also leading.
If the body is turned at a minor angle to the electronic camera, the apparent range between the shoulders is minimized and the figure appears thinner (Chino Hills Graduation Pictures Photographers Near Me). When the weight of the body is moved to the back leg, the back shoulder naturally drops, which once more makes the individual look even more all-natural and makes the slumping over stance unseen
The all-natural setting of an unwinded head is a small tilt to the side, and this body movement can be made use of in a portrait. By turning the head towards the elevated front shoulder, the face shows up narrower, and since the chin is decreased, the eyes are a lot more meaningful, providing the posture freedom and femininity.
The eyes are the most integral part of any kind of picture. Make sure to regulate the direction of the stare, whether it is directly right into the lens or to the side. When a person explores the lens, also the basic motion of the chin up or down produces a different mood.
When a person looks away from the camera, the expression in the eyes is harder to catch. When you switch to a resting position, the body movement changes substantially: all individuals, without exemption, are much less strained and a lot more relaxed when they are sitting. When you ask people to being in a chair, they most often rest as they do in your home, as they are comfortable.
Much more usually than not, the photographer requires to remedy the pose of the person sitting. Transform the chair so that it is at a small angle to the video camera.
The means a person leans on the armrests or leans back in a chair can be used to change the life of a position and the mood of a shot. A person leaning forward toward the video camera looks more open, and alternatively, when an individual leans back in a chair while leaning on the far armrest, the mood of the portrait darkens.
The floor is a good surface for a posture, particularly in a tiny space or a room with a low ceiling. In the crouching pose, the entire weight of the body is moved to the toes, but some people have problem keeping their balance. The crouch gives a natural seek to the image.
If the individual is leaning ahead or to the side, the proportions of their body are distorted, making the portrait state of mind more hostile. If the individual is resting on the floor, notice that the hips naturally expand and the body appears extra huge. A much better position is when the person is remaining on one leg (on one side), so that the hips are encountering the video camera.
A person's arms can be remarkably expressive. Awkwardly bent arms can destroy a portrait. Luckily, there are a couple of basic techniques that will always get you a great outcome. Hands can be the centerpiece of a portrait, bringing an individual's present to life and showing particular personality characteristics. They can also ruin a portrait if they are as well big or as well intense.
If they are trivial, ensure your hands are out of the limelight, or take them out of the photo and placed them in your pocket or behind your back. In the latter case, leave your thumbs out of the pockets, as it looks much better than having your hands totally hidden in your pocket.
When the hands are over waistline degree, the wrist ought to be slightly bent and the hand needs to be directing up, it looks much more natural. When the arms are below the midsection, allow them hang openly, as this is the setting they are in when we are standing. The arm can actually control the framework, specifically when it faces the camera with its vast side.
This is a lot more pleasing to the eye and makes the hand appearance thinner. Most of individuals you deal with will certainly end up being buddies with each various other or perhaps family participants. The ability to comprehend and disclose these connections in a portrait counts on your observation skills in addition to your capability to communicate with individuals.
Engaged or married individuals have a tendency to reveal their feelings a lot more openly, and they may be standing very close together, touching their heads. The brother and sibling in the picture do not stand so near each other and seldom also hold hands, one might also place a hand on the other's shoulder.
The secret is to observe the family before you start organizing the group for the portrait. Try to picture families with strained relationships as swiftly as feasible, without investing a great deal of time establishing the lights. Commonly, the core of the household team is the moms and dads, so they are placed in the center and the youngsters border the moms and dads, lined up by age.
Usually, they are associated to the requirement to place a participant of the family members behind the others in order to produce a more complementary pose and composition. In this situation, the digital photographer typically places all the household members to make sure that their shoulders are transformed towards the middle of the picture and their heads are a little tilted toward the center of the group.
Maybe the most moving connection in a portrait is between a parent and a child, specifically a newborn. Their all-natural affection for each various other makes for remarkable photographs. With such a portrait, there is no demand to create anything, just allow the emotions flow. It is best to position the electronic camera at the height of the youngster to make sure that you do not have to look down on him, so it is all-natural to hop on the floor with him.
